Jim Fehlig 702911496f libxl: Domain event handler improvements
Since libxl provides the domain ID in the event handler callback,
find the domain object based on the ID.  This approach prevents
processing the callback on a domain that has already been reaped.

Also, similar to the xl implementation, ignore the SUSPEND shutdown
reason.  By calling libxl_domain_suspend(), we know a shutdown
event with SUSPEND reason will be generated, but it can be safely
ignored since any subsequent cleanup will be done by the callers.

         LibVirt : simple API for virtualization

  Libvirt is a C toolkit to interact with the virtualization capabilities
of recent versions of Linux (and other OSes). It is free software
available under the GNU Lesser General Public License. Virtualization of
the Linux Operating System means the ability to run multiple instances of
Operating Systems concurrently on a single hardware system where the basic
resources are driven by a Linux instance. The library aim at providing
long term stable C API initially for the Xen paravirtualization but
should be able to integrate other virtualization mechanisms if needed.
